ABSTRACT
OBJECTIVE@#To construct a biodegradable PLGA nerve conduit (NC) filled with NSCs in order to improve facial nerve regeneration.@*METHOD@#SD rats were subjected to right facial nerve transection, and PLGA NCs filled with NSCs were used to bridge the nerve gap. Facial nerve regeneration was assessed 4 and 12 weeks after surgery, through electrophysiological testing, and morphometric analysis of axons.@*RESULT@#Nerve action potential amplitude, and axonal area were significantly greater in the NSCs group than the empty NC group.@*CONCLUSION@#NSCs transplantation may improve regeneration of the facial nerve.
